Instructions
Preheat oven to 350 F.
In a large mixing bowl, combine all the dry ingredients including the chocolate chips.
In a separate medium mixing bowl, combine all the wet ingredients, whisking well to combine.
Combine the wet and dry ingredients and stir gently with a wooden spoon until well mixed.
Pour the batter into three mini loaf pans and place those loaf pans on a cookie sheet.
Bake for approximately 30 minutes or until a knife inserted in the center of the loaves pulls out clean.
Remove from oven and allow to cool. Remove from pans, place in a food-safe container and store in the refrigerator.
